What Is Wrong with the Federal Council? now known as the National Council of the Churches of Christ in the U.S.A.
New York: American Council of Christian Churches, 1950. Revised. 12mo; plain, stapled wrappers, 24 pp. First published in 1948 by the Fundamentalist pastor, Garman accuses the Federal Council of anti-Americanism, near-Communism, and of being anti-Christian. The Federal Council (or National Council of the Churches of Christ) became a frequent target of Christian Fundamentalists and the anti-Communist right for its social justice mission and connections with civil rights organizations. A final edition was published in 1957 and expanded to 30 pp. Currently (Aug., 2018), no copies of any edition in commerce. Item #05658
